The University of Copenhagen is seeking a postdoctoral researcher for a 1.5-year fellowship focused on the processing and structuring of plant-dairy hybrid foods. This position is part of the BoostDairy project, which aims to valorise dairy industry side streams and develop novel hybrid food products. The postdoc will engage in research, teaching, and collaboration with a PhD candidate, emphasizing process optimization and structural characterization. Applicants should possess a PhD related to the subject area and have experience in food processing, dairy technology, and teaching. The position starts on January 1, 2027, and applications are due by August 31, 2026.
